If disconnect event happened right before sending next VHOST-USER command, then the vhost_dev_set_log() call in the vhost_migration_log() function will return error. This error will lead to the assert() and close the QEMU migration source process. This additional flag in the VhostUserBlk structure will be used to track whether the device really needs to be stopped and cleaned up on a vhost-user level. The disconnect event will set the overall VHOST device (not vhost-user) to the stopped state, so it can be used by the general vhost_migration_log routine. Such approach could be propogated to the other vhost-user devices, but better idea is just to make the same connect/disconnect code for all the vhost-user devices. The vhost_virtqueue_start() routine handles such case by checking the return value from the virtio_queue_get_desc_addr() function call. Add the same check to the vhost_dev_set_log() routine.
